EXPANDED BROADCAST TIME ON FREE SATELLITE UPLINK FOR JAN. 18 PROTESTS
A free worldwide satellite uplink of the action has now
been EXPANDED to 6 hours, from 11 a.m. to 5 p.m., and will include the rally at the Washington Navy Yard, as well as the opening rally at the National Mall. (See details
below, which contain NEW details on how to do uplinking.)
FREE WORLDWIDE BROADCAST OF 1/18 ANTI-WAR RALLY
The Voices of Solidarity -- Satellite Uplink Project will
carry the full, 6-hour live coverage of the Saturday,
January 18, 2003, National March on Washington Against the War in Iraq, and will uplink that coverage to satellite
for free distribution to media outlets and public access
stations in the Middle East, Asia, Europe, the United
States and worldwide. This satellite uplink is organized
by Multi-Media Group, Peace TV, Free Speech TV, World Link and People's Video Network working with and the
A.N.S.W.E.R. Coalition.
The Voices of Solidarity -- Satellite Uplink Project will
bring a message of peace to millions around the world.

Voices of Solidarity Satellite Uplink Project will
broadcast on Saturday, Jan 18 from: 11:00 am to 4:00 pm ET -- This is: 16:00 to 21:00 GT. In North America the
broadcast is from 11:00 am to 5:00 pm.
Within the U.S., public access stations and many
universities have the facilities to downlink this historic
demonstration. Media outlets around the world can use this service. The 4 to 6 hour live coverage (including the
rallies, march and interviews) can be down linked FREE for immediate live broadcast or taped for later use.
